Exception when using the scheduler

PatrickMueller
Level 3

I am facing an issue I never had before.

When I trigger a process manually by dragging and dropping a process to the resource, the process is executed without any issue just perfectly.

However, when I create a schedule and the schedule triggers the process on the resource OR even right click "Run Now" (does not make a difference) - the process does not run on the resource - we receive in the report the following entry:

35937.png

When I drag and drop the Logout (or any other process) to the resource and run it - it works. I have no idea what could cause that.

Any idea ?
